US Intelligent Vehicle Systems Market: The Integration of AI and Advanced Technologies Shaping the Future of Mobility
Focusing on the integration of artificial intelligence and advanced technologies in the US intelligent vehicle systems market, covering the smart vehicle functionalities, autonomous features, and the innovations driving the next generation of mobility through 2035.
The US Intelligent Vehicle Systems Market is at the forefront of automotive innovation, integrating artificial intelligence, advanced driver assistance systems, and connectivity technologies to create smarter, safer, and more intuitive vehicles. According to Market Research Future analysis, the broader US software-defined vehicle market was valued at approximately $67.58 billion in 2024 and is projected to reach $82.84 billion by 2035, exhibiting a CAGR of 1.87%. The integration of artificial intelligence into vehicles is a notable trend within the software defined-vehicle market, with AI technologies being utilized to enhance driver assistance systems, improve navigation, and personalize user experiences. This trend indicates a shift towards smarter, more intuitive vehicles that adapt to individual preferences. The OEMs end-user segment currently holds the largest market share, capturing substantial investments and innovations in software capabilities, while Fleet Operators are positioned as the fastest-growing segment as more companies leverage technology for enhanced fleet management.
Intelligent vehicle systems are vital for enabling the next generation of mobility, providing the advanced software and hardware solutions that enable autonomous driving, enhanced safety, and seamless connectivity. The growing demand for US Intelligent Vehicle Systems is a direct response to the increasing consumer expectations for safety, convenience, and smart vehicle features. The software defined-vehicle market is currently experiencing a transformative phase, with vehicles evolving from traditional mechanical systems to sophisticated platforms that rely heavily on software. This transition not only improves vehicle performance but also opens new revenue streams for manufacturers through software services. The Driver Assistance Software segment is the fastest-growing category, driven by rising safety regulations and consumer demand for adv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S). The ADAS segment is projected to grow at a CAGR of approximately 20% through 2027.
The adoption of intelligent vehicle systems is being driven by several factors, including technological advancements in AI and machine learning, the rising demand for autonomous driving capabilities, and the increasing focus on connectivity and data analytics. The integration of AI and machine learning capabilities is fueling the growth of the Driver Assistance Software segment, enabling features such as lane-keeping assistance and adaptive cruise control. The push towards electrification and sustainability in vehicle operations is further boosting the adoption of software defined vehicles, facilitating better efficiency and data management for operational success. In October 2025, Tesla announced a partnership with a leading AI firm to enhance its autonomous driving algorithms, aiming to improve the safety and efficiency of its self-driving technology. In September 2025, General Motors unveiled its new software platform designed to streamline vehicle updates and enhance connectivity.
